The Kent Denver Sun Devils had to kick off their season on the road on Monday, but they showed no ill effects. They simply couldn't be stopped as they easily beat DSST: Cedar 85-44 on the road. That's another feather in the cap for Kent Denver, who also won these teams' last head-to-head.
Kent Denver was led to victory by Anya Peper and Austin Duncan. Peper scored 23 points along with 8 steals and 5 rebounds, while Duncan dropped a double-double on 21 points and 25 rebounds. Another player making a difference was Caroline Phillips, who scored 15 points along with 7 steals.
Despite the defeat, DSST: Cedar saw an underclassman step up: Amaya Paul scored 13 points along with 5 steals. The team also got some help courtesy of Hannah Rhodes, who scored 11 points.
Kent Denver's win bumped their record up to 1-0. As for DSST: Cedar, their loss dropped their record down to 0-1.
